How to start

Email support@airspaceevaluator.com with your organization, intended use case, airport or airfield type, expected criteria family, user count, and whether you need single-use, team, agency, or enterprise access.

Current purchasing posture

  • Demo registration is self-service from the Home or Plans page.
  • Single-use evaluations are handled through manual billing.
  • Supported self-service plans can start secure checkout from the Plans page.
  • Enterprise/manual access and organization-specific purchasing still route through quotes, manual invoice handling, or rollout discussion.
  • Purchase order discussion is available where appropriate.
  • Government or organization-specific procurement questions can still be handled directly with the Clear Path team.

Government and organizational use notes

Government, airport, installation, consultant, and engineering users must follow their own procurement, ethics, cybersecurity, records, and approval processes. Clear Path supports planning, obstruction screening, criteria-based evaluation, report documentation, and decision support.

References to FAA, DoD, UFC, Part 77, or airport criteria identify source criteria only and do not imply endorsement, sponsorship, authorization, approval, or official status by any agency, command, military unit, or airport authority.
